Step 4: stand up the bloom filter sidecar in front of Cellarstore. The filter keeps pointless lookups from ever touching the KV nodes, which saved us a ton of read load last quarter. Grab the latest filter snapshot from the Quillback artifact bucket and mount it read-only. The sidecar needs to authenticate to Cellarstore's admin plane to stream membership updates, and yes, that credential is separate from the app token. Add this line to the sidecar's env file before starting it:

secret setting of yajog-taguf: ARCHIVE_KEY3=051

Handover: Relino gateway websocket reconnect bug. Clients drop after ~90s idle, then reconnect storm hits the edge tier. Root cause likely the heartbeat timer resetting only on sends, not receives. Patch drafted on branch fix/ws-heartbeat; needs soak test on staging cluster Brell-2 before merge. Watch metric ws_reconnect_rate — anything over 40/min is bad. Tovan owns rollout Thursday; I'm out Friday. Don't bump the idle timeout as a workaround, it masks the bug. Full repro notes and timeline are on the internal tracker page.

wiki page, tahaf-tajog: https://jira.ordindyn.corp/pipeline

### CI Note: Parcelpath Webhook Plugin Builds

If your plugin's webhook contract tests fail with signature mismatches, the fixtures are likely stale — regenerate them against the current schema before retrying. The CI image pins the validator version, so local passes can still fail remotely. Match your local run against the pipeline token below.

pipeline stamp: htk3_69f

Plugin authors should
// note that limits are enforced per-plugin-slot, not per-tenant, so bursty
// retries from a single slot will exhaust the budget quickly. Prefer
// exponential backoff with jitter; the gateway returns a Retry-After hint
// on rejection. Do not change this constant without coordinating with the
// Corvex platform team, since downstream quotas assume this window. For
// support, quote the trace token emitted below.

trace token, kawip-fafog: htk14_26e64c4d35154e